Cultists Show No Mercy, Hunt Down Son Of Community Leader, See What They Did To Him
A middle- aged man who goes by the name, Fatai Kehinde, a 48- year- old PoS operator, was mercilessly murdered by some suspected cultists under the Kuto bridge in Abeokuta, the capital city of Ogun state over the weekend, precisely on Friday night.
It was said that attackers who followed the PoS operator, known by his nickname Faithy and also known as the son of the Baale of Kuto Community, Abeokuta, from his store within Kuto Market to under bridge where they assassinated him.
Shockingly, the murder is reported to have occurred shortly after the approximately four days interval after the gruesome murder of a different young man who worked as a barber at Isale Oja Kuto.
Reporters concluded that since the attackers used the same car as the barber’ s murderers had used on Friday, the victims were probably murdered by the same cult rival group.
It was said that Faithy was buried on Saturday, 10th August 2024 at around 2: 00 pm.
Talking with the reporter on Saturday, a trustworthy Kuto community source who refused to give his identity claimed that, ” the killing happened last night at about 11 pm” .
” He is popularly called Faithy, he is the son of Baale of Kuto. He operates a POS shop and was about to close for the day when his killers drove to his shop” .
The source went on to say that, ” one of them was said to have pretended to be a customer that wanted to withdraw money, about three other guys who wore masks then came out and shot at their target” .
” However, the shot was said not to have penetrated and so he tried to escape by taking to his heels but his assailants caught up with him under Kuto bridge and butchered him to death” .
” It’ s possible that the assailants who killed Faithy were the same gang who murdered the barber at Isale Oja Kuto about four days ago because we gathered that the assailants used the same jeep vehicle for their dastardly act” , he asserted.
Reacting to the heinous act of the unknown killers of the deceased, CP Abiodun Alamutu, the Commissioner of Police, acknowledged the depressing and ugly event on Saturday as well while urging his men to dive into action as soon as possible in order to hunt down the perpetrators and expose them so that they can pay dearly for their crimes.
The CP added that, ” the command is aware of the two incidents and efforts are ongoing to apprehend those behind the killings” .
